如何修复网页代码

修复网页代码首先需定位问题,使用浏览器开发者工具检查错误。接着,逐行检查HTML、CSS和JavaScript代码,确保标签闭合、属性正确。使用在线代码验证工具如W3C验证器进一步排查。最后,进行多浏览器测试,确保兼容性。优化代码结构,提高加载速度,增强用户体验。

imagesource from: pexels

网页代码问题:用户体验与SEO的双重隐患

在数字化时代,网页代码的健壮性直接关系到网站的生死存亡。你是否曾遇到过页面加载缓慢、布局错乱,甚至无法正常访问的情况?这些常见现象背后,往往隐藏着网页代码的种种问题。不仅用户体验大打折扣,搜索引擎的排名也会因此一落千丈。试想,一个充斥着错误代码的网站,如何能在激烈的网络竞争中脱颖而出?及时修复网页代码,不仅是对用户负责,更是对SEO优化的必要投资。让我们一同揭开代码问题的面纱,探寻高效修复之道,为网站的健康运行保驾护航。

一、定位网页代码问题

在修复网页代码的过程中,首要任务是精准定位问题所在。这不仅能为后续的修复工作节省大量时间,还能确保问题得到彻底解决,避免反复出现。以下是两种高效的定位方法:

1、使用浏览器开发者工具

现代浏览器如Chrome、Firefox等均内置了强大的开发者工具,这些工具是定位代码问题的利器。通过按下F12键或右键点击页面元素选择“检查”,即可打开开发者工具。

  • 控制台(Console):这里会显示页面加载过程中的错误和警告信息,如JavaScript语法错误、资源加载失败等。通过这些提示,可以快速定位到具体的代码行。
  • 元素(Elements):此选项卡展示了页面的DOM结构,便于查看和修改HTML标签及其属性。遇到样式问题时,可以在此处实时调整CSS属性,观察效果。
  • 网络(Network):用于监控页面加载的资源,如图片、脚本、样式表等。若页面加载缓慢或资源加载失败,这里会提供详细的信息。

2、常见错误类型及表现

了解常见的代码错误类型及其表现,有助于更高效地定位问题。

  • HTML错误

    • 标签未闭合:如
      标签未对应闭合,会导致页面布局错乱。
    • 属性错误:如标签的src属性缺失,图片无法显示。
  • CSS错误

    • 选择器错误:如类选择器前缺少.,导致样式无法应用。
    • 属性值错误:如color属性值拼写错误,导致颜色无法正常显示。
  • JavaScript错误

    • 语法错误:如缺少分号、括号不匹配等,会导致脚本无法执行。
    • 引用错误:如未定义的变量或函数被调用,控制台会显示错误信息。

通过以上方法,可以迅速定位到网页代码中的问题,为后续的修复工作奠定坚实基础。记住,精准定位问题是成功修复代码的第一步。

二、逐行检查HTML、CSS和JavaScript代码

在定位了网页代码问题后,接下来的关键步骤是逐行检查HTML、CSS和JavaScript代码。这一过程不仅有助于发现细微的错误,还能确保代码的规范性和可维护性。

1. HTML标签闭合检查

HTML标签的正确闭合是网页正常显示的基础。一个未闭合的标签可能会导致整个页面布局错乱。使用文本编辑器的搜索功能,查找常见的标签如

等,确保每个标签都有对应的闭合标签。例如,检查以下代码段:

Welcome

确保每个

标签都有相应的

闭合标签。

2. CSS属性验证

CSS属性的准确性直接影响网页的视觉效果。逐行检查CSS文件,确保每个属性值符合规范。例如,检查以下CSS代码:

.header {    background-color: #f00; /* 确保颜色值正确 */    padding: 10px; /* 确保单位正确 */}

使用浏览器的开发者工具,实时查看样式应用效果,验证属性值是否正确。

3. JavaScript语法校验

JavaScript的语法错误会导致脚本无法执行,影响网页的交互功能。逐行检查JavaScript代码,特别注意括号、引号和分号的匹配。例如:

function greeting() {    alert("Hello, World!"); // 确保引号和分号使用正确}

使用在线JavaScript语法校验工具,如JSHint,进一步确保代码无语法错误。

通过逐行检查HTML、CSS和JavaScript代码,不仅能发现并修复显性错误,还能提升代码的整体质量,从而优化用户体验和SEO效果。

三、利用在线工具验证代码

在手动检查代码后,利用在线工具进行验证是确保网页代码质量的另一重要步骤。这些工具不仅能快速发现隐藏的错误,还能提供详细的修复建议。

1、W3C验证器的使用

W3C验证器是网页开发者的必备工具之一。它能够对HTML、CSS代码进行全面的验证,确保代码符合W3C标准。使用方法简单:只需将网页的URL或代码片段粘贴到验证器中,点击“检查”按钮,系统便会列出所有错误和警告。例如,常见的HTML错误包括未闭合的标签、属性值缺失等,而CSS错误则可能是属性拼写错误或无效的值。

2、其他常用代码验证工具

除了W3C验证器,还有多种在线工具可以帮助开发者验证代码:

  • CSS Lint:专门用于CSS代码的验证,能够检测出冗余代码、不规范的书写格式等问题。
  • JSHint:针对JavaScript代码的验证工具,可以检查语法错误、潜在的性能问题等。
  • HTML Tidy:不仅能验证HTML代码,还能自动修复一些常见的错误,提升代码整洁度。

使用这些工具时,建议将代码分段验证,以便更精确地定位问题。同时,结合工具提供的修复建议,逐步优化代码,提升网页的整体质量。

通过在线工具的辅助验证,不仅能提高代码的准确性,还能有效提升网页的加载速度和用户体验,进而对SEO产生积极影响。

四、多浏览器测试确保兼容性

在进行网页代码修复的过程中,多浏览器测试是不可或缺的一环。这一步骤旨在确保你的网页在不同的浏览器和设备上都能正常显示和运行,从而提升用户体验和SEO效果。

1、主流浏览器测试

主流浏览器如Chrome、Firefox、Safari和Edge占据了大部分市场份额,因此在这些浏览器上进行测试至关重要。每个浏览器对HTML、CSS和JavaScript的解析方式略有不同,可能导致相同的代码在不同浏览器上表现出差异。

  • Chrome:作为市场份额最大的浏览器,Chrome提供了强大的开发者工具,方便调试。
  • Firefox:其Firebug插件是开发者调试CSS和JavaScript的利器。
  • Safari:在Mac和iOS设备上广泛使用,需特别注意其独特的渲染引擎。
  • Edge:基于Chromium的新版Edge,与Chrome兼容性较好,但仍需单独测试。

通过在不同浏览器中打开网页,检查布局、功能和性能,可以及时发现并修复兼容性问题。

2、移动端兼容性检查

随着移动设备的普及,移动端兼容性同样不可忽视。使用手机和平板电脑访问网页时,屏幕尺寸、分辨率和操作方式的不同都可能影响用户体验。

  • 响应式设计:确保网页在不同尺寸的屏幕上都能自适应显示。
  • 触摸操作:检查触摸事件如点击、滑动是否响应正常。
  • 加载速度:移动网络环境下,网页加载速度尤为重要。

可以使用模拟器初步测试,但更推荐在实际设备上进行验证,以获得最真实的用户体验。

通过多浏览器测试,不仅能发现并解决兼容性问题,还能提升网页在不同环境下的稳定性和性能,从而优化SEO表现,吸引更多用户访问。

结语:优化代码结构,提升用户体验

修复网页代码不仅是解决当前问题的应急措施,更是提升网站整体性能的长远投资。通过定位问题、逐行检查、在线验证和多浏览器测试,我们确保了代码的准确性和兼容性。优化后的代码结构不仅能显著提高网站加载速度,还能极大地改善用户体验,从而间接提升搜索引擎排名。持续关注代码质量,是每一位网站开发者应有的职业素养。让我们携手打造高效、流畅的网络环境,为用户提供更优质的浏览体验。

常见问题

1、修复代码时遇到的最常见问题是什么?

在修复网页代码时,最常见的問題通常是标签未闭合、CSS属性不兼容和JavaScript语法错误。这些小错误可能导致页面布局错乱、功能失效,甚至无法加载。例如,一个未闭合的

标签会导致整个页面的结构混乱,而一个错误的CSS属性则可能使元素显示异常。

2、如何快速定位代码错误?

快速定位代码错误的方法之一是使用浏览器的开发者工具。通过按F12打开开发者工具,可以在“Elements”面板中查看HTML结构,在“Console”面板中查看JavaScript错误,在“Sources”面板中调试代码。此外,使用“Network”面板可以检查资源加载情况,迅速找到问题所在。

3、有哪些免费的在线代码验证工具推荐?

推荐几款免费的在线代码验证工具:首先是W3C验证器,它能够全面检查HTML和CSS代码的合法性;其次是JSHint,专门用于JavaScript代码的语法检查;还有CSS Lint,专注于CSS代码的优化建议。这些工具都能帮助开发者及时发现并修复代码中的错误。

4、多浏览器测试的重要性是什么?

多浏览器测试至关重要,因为它能确保网页在不同浏览器和设备上都能正常显示和运行。由于不同浏览器内核和渲染机制不同,同一个页面在不同浏览器中可能出现兼容性问题。通过多浏览器测试,可以及时发现并解决这些问题,提升用户体验。

5、代码优化对SEO有何影响?

代码优化对SEO有着显著影响。优化后的代码结构更清晰,加载速度更快,搜索引擎爬虫能更高效地抓取页面内容。此外,合理的标签使用和语义化代码还能提升页面的可读性,进而提高搜索引擎排名。因此,代码优化是提升SEO效果的重要手段之一。

原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/64519.html

(0)
上一篇 1天前
下一篇 1天前

相关推荐

  • css如何去掉边框下

    要去除CSS中的边框,可以使用`border: none;`或`border: 0;`。具体操作如下:在目标元素的样式规则中添加`border: none;`,例如`div { border: none; }`。若需针对特定边框,可用`border-bottom: none;`。确保检查是否有其他样式覆盖。

    4秒前
    0470
  • 如何使用织梦建站

    织梦建站简单易用,首先下载并安装DedeCMS系统,选择合适的模板,通过后台管理进行内容添加和页面布局。利用其强大的标签功能,快速生成静态页面,优化SEO。注意定期更新和维护,确保网站安全稳定。

    13秒前
    0365
  • 如何粘贴网站统计代码

    要粘贴网站统计代码,首先登录网站后台,找到代码管理或统计设置模块。复制你的统计代码(如Google Analytics代码),然后在相应位置粘贴,通常是或标签内。保存设置后,清除网站缓存以确保代码生效。测试网站统计功能,确认数据正常收集。

    26秒前
    0429
  • ai如何用手绘板

    AI结合手绘板可实现高效创作。首先,安装驱动并连接手绘板至电脑。选择支持手绘板的AI软件,如Adobe Illustrator或Clip Studio Paint。调整笔触和压力感应,开始绘制草图。利用AI工具进行细化、上色和优化,提升作品细节和表现力。手绘板让AI创作更自然、精准。

    49秒前
    0174
  • 如何凸显网站文字层级

    要凸显网站文字层级,首先使用合适的标题标签(如H1、H2、H3),确保主次分明。其次,通过字体大小、颜色和粗细的变化来区分不同层级的文字。合理运用空白和段落间距,提升阅读体验。最后,利用CSS样式表进行细致调整,确保一致性。

    59秒前
    0145
  • 如何保存网页的排版

    要保存网页的排版,首先可使用浏览器的“另存为”功能,选择“网页,全部”格式保存,保留HTML和图片等资源。其次,利用截图工具如截图软件或浏览器自带的截图功能,完整捕捉页面排版。高级用户可尝试使用开发者工具,提取网页CSS和HTML代码,手动保存并重现在本地环境。

    1分钟前
    0461
  • 网站没备案如何备案

    网站备案是确保合法运营的关键步骤。首先,登录工信部备案管理系统,注册账号并填写相关信息。准备企业营业执照、法人身份证等材料,上传至系统。按照指引填写网站信息,包括域名、服务器IP等。提交审核后,耐心等待,通常需20个工作日。期间如有问题,及时修改并重新提交。

    1分钟前
    0259
  • 原创保护功能如何开通

    要开通原创保护功能,首先登录平台账号,进入设置中心,找到版权保护选项。点击进入后,按照提示填写相关信息,包括原创声明、作品类型等。提交申请后,平台会进行审核,通常1-3个工作日内完成。审核通过后,原创保护功能即可生效,有效防止内容被抄袭。

    1分钟前
    0347
  • 如何优化网站信息架构

    优化网站信息架构的关键在于清晰的用户导航和内容组织。首先,进行用户需求分析,确定核心内容。其次,设计逻辑清晰的导航结构,确保用户能快速找到所需信息。最后,使用SEO友好的URL和标签,提升搜索引擎抓取效率。定期审查和优化架构,保持其灵活性和适应性。

    2分钟前
    0329

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注